collapse
獘 centers on collapse or ruin, often in a destructive or fatal sense. The single given meaning 'collapse' is the core idea.
獘 combines 敝 (worn out, ruined) and 犬 (dog), suggesting a dog that is worn out or collapsing. The exact historical development is uncertain, but the components point to ruin or collapse.
A worn-out, tattered dog (敝 + 犬) finally collapses from exhaustion.
For ヘイ, imagine the dog collapsing with a heavy 'hey' sigh: hey -> ヘイ.
